Good Boost – Accessible rehabilitation made easy
Welcome to Good Boost at Active Hartlepool!
Good Boost is a social enterprise that delivers affordable, accessible therapeutic exercise programmes using cutting-edge technology. Designed to make rehabilitation fun and effective, Good Boost helps people with a wide range of musculoskeletal (MSK) conditions, including arthritis, back pain, and joint issues.

Session types
Aqua Sessions
Enjoy personalised aquatic exercise in the pool.
- Duration: 20 to 40 minutes
- Tailored to your condition, mobility, and preferences
- Uses real-time feedback via the Good Boost app
Dry Sessions
Land-based sessions in community venues.
- Duration: 10 to 30 minutes
- Adapted to your needs and available equipment
